100% commission, ... mostly ALL evenings and weekends -- lucky if not 7 days/ week -- always worrying about 'the Hustle' HUGE territory, (i put 95kms on SUV in 9 mos!! + $4000 407 bills every half year just to save time -- because Time was Money!) Office Politics -- if you do not bring in 'Self-generated contracts' on order of 8-10 per month then you are LOCKED out of getting company leads... which you are PROMISED in job interviewing etc..... and unless you are willing to bank YEARS to build up your clientele base to weather this -- OR go door-knocking MANY hours every day (which they are now on the News about BANNING Door-to-door sales of ANY KIND!!!!) Slooooooooow to Respond to competitive Marketplace -- Did NOT react to outside HUGE competitive factors, like a MAJOR New competitor player entering Consumer Marketk Sloooooooow, Archaic AS 400 computer system for Quoting... and 'time is $$' to a 100% commission salesperson!!! Management bickers with each other ... and it's HIGH PRESSURE all the time. Offers Benefits -- 70/30 mix and it's expensive to pay in to. Car allowance was less than $100/ month ... for EVERYTHING... car lease, maintenance, repairs, gas, etc... The month i had to PAY to go to work is when I gave my notice!!! Average cost $800/ month in gas + $500/ mo 407 charges + Repairs and I didn't even have a car payment to worry about!!!
